Day one of the 2018 AFL trade period has drawn to a close, leaving us with plenty to ponder as talks progress.

Three deals were completed:

- Lincoln McCarthy, a close friend of Lachie Neale, moved from Geelong to Brisbane;

- Former Richmond pair Anthony Miles and Corey Ellis became Gold Coast Suns; and

- Geelong snaffled talented SANFL tall and Carlton pre-selection pick Nathan Kreuger.

In other news:

- Geelong is demanding a top-10 pick for homesick midfielder Tim Kelly;

- GWS ruck-forward Rory Lobb wants to become a Docker;

- West Coast could match Port Adelaide’s free agency offer to Scott Lycett;

- A Halls Creek forward could shape this year’s trade period; and

- A WA-born Bulldogs defender is eyeing up a move to Brisbane.
